What to do if you find a stray in Winnipeg
- 1
If the pet seems safe to approach, check for a collar and tag
A visible phone number or tag is often the fastest path to reuniting the pet with their family.
- 2
Take a clear photo and note the exact location
Photos are the single biggest factor in matching a stray to a lost-pet listing.
- 3

- 4
Take the pet to a shelter or vet to scan for a microchip
Most shelters scan for free. Vets can also check the microchip registry.
- 5
If you can safely hold the pet, do so
Many owners aren't nearby to pick up immediately. If you can't hold them, at least mark where and when you saw them.
Shelters and rescues near Winnipeg
Contacting local shelters is one of the most important steps in reuniting a lost pet. Many shelters only hold stray animals for 72 hours, so call the ones nearest where your pet was last seen as soon as you can.
